CrOS FR: SNMP protocol compatibility with Chrome OS devices

Project Member Reported by cardonam@google.com, Nov 9

Issue description

Summary: A customer requests Simple Network Management Protocol compatibility and documentation to be applied to Chrome OS devices and that the current compatibility or lack of it is documented in a help center article.


Use case / Motivation:
The customer is setting up an asset management and audit application and wishes to request that Chrome OS devices are discoverable by it using the SNMP protocol.  This would apply for all Chrome OS devices including but not limited for Chromebooks, Google for Meetings and if possible for Jamboard as well.

Existing workarounds:
No known workaround
